Level Ten performance transmission group buy

Anyone interested in a group buy on Level Ten performance transmission? They will offer a discount of up to about 13% for group purchases of 6 or more on a package which includes a performance transmission system, a pts hydrosystem upgrade, and a pts converter upgrade. It's still pricey- about $3864, but its a great system.

Before committing yours and other 420M I suggest you may want to ask for comments on Level 10 expereince on SVX. I had a 95 LSI I bought new and came upon a 97 LSI with 16M original miles on it in 1999 which I bought and sold my 95 to my son with 77M miles on it. less than 15M miles later he needed a trans and as we are a stones throw from Level we naturally went there.

Their reputation is very good but our experience with the full change over you noted was not a good one. It was in for nearly 6 weeks and then in and out over the next 2 months. It never was right and my son got rid of it several months later. His wife will not let another in their house.

I picked up a 94 LSI in May 03 and have been bringing it up to near new. It is highly likely there is a new trans in my future and plan not to take it there.

This was almost 4 years ago and may have been the proverbial lemon. But checking first may be worthwhile.

i live five miles from the owner of level 10 and when my transmission went i seriously considered going the level 10 route. However the main thing is that they offer absolutely no warranty whatsoever, now to spend at least 3k and not get any sort of warranty is foolish, in my opinion. Especially when subaru has a 3 year 36k mile one for about 500 dollars more. And secondly level 10 advertises to produce BULLETPROOF trannies, there is a member on here who recently bought an svx here with a level 10 tranny and it went south on him. This is the reason I would not go to level 10.

If you are close to level 10 i highly recommend going where i went. The place is called tri-state transmissions, wasn't anything special, took about a month to do because of a backlog, but the entire rebuilt cost 2000 and that came with a one year 10k mile warranty. I've been happy with it so far.

That's another option, if you want performance go the 5spd route and save some money. Good luck, chris

I have a second hand trany that has the Level10 Valve body, Got the trany with 15k on it, put on another 10k so far, still works fine. I do regular Trany fluid changes and added the trany cooler.
So my level 10 experience is positive, so far anyways.

just an fyi, your rebuild is only as good as the core you get rebuilt.

From what I understand, the wiring harness for the later model cars is different from the earlier models. I've known a couple of people with 96 and 97 models that had difficulty with the Level 10. Those who've had them installed in their 92's (Or thw one's I've known) haven't had any difficulty, that I know of.
